Stormfront Retail
  • Tel: 0800-612 1044 / 08006121044
  • Region: Devon
  • City: Exeter
  • Adress: Unit 1b/The Newton Centre/Thorberton Road
  • Zipcode: EX2 8GN
Profile
Stormfront Retail in Exeter, Devon, is a computer support company who offers computer support and PC support. Stormfront Retail computer support company is located at the following address - Unit 1b/The Newton Centre/Thorberton Road.
Map
Google Map of Stormfront Retail address:Unit 1b/The Newton Centre/Thorberton Road,Exeter,United Kingdom.
If you find 'Can Not Find' or error address, please submit another address using the form in the map, then search again.